Output 21eb05c05ffe62728168084ca31455bca68286f5ad050f99c80eaeb10a71158d:1

value
1377072
script pubkey
OP_0 OP_PUSHBYTES_20 bfa860069deac2ae67c0ceafc2486bd4dbfd798d
address
bc1qh75xqp5aatp2ue7qe6huyjrt6ndl67vdu7swvr
transaction
21eb05c05ffe62728168084ca31455bca68286f5ad050f99c80eaeb10a71158d
spent
true